Feature Comparison
Looker Studio connects directly to Google Search Console, GA4, Google Ads, and dozens of third-party connectors through its Community Connectors program. You can pull data from Semrush, Ahrefs, Facebook Ads, and hundreds of other sources into completely custom dashboards. The platform handles complex data blending, calculated fields, and advanced filtering that most reporting tools can't match. DashThis focuses purely on automation and client presentation. It connects to 30+ marketing platforms including all major SEO tools, but the real value is in its pre-built templates and automated report generation. You select your data sources, choose a template, and DashThis handles the rest. Reports auto-generate and can be scheduled for automatic delivery to clients. Where Looker Studio excels in data manipulation and custom visualizations, DashThis wins on speed to value. Looker Studio dashboards can take hours or days to build properly. DashThis reports are ready in under 30 minutes.
Pricing Comparison
Looker Studio is completely free for unlimited dashboards and viewers. The only costs come from third-party connector subscriptions (typically $10-50/month) if you need data beyond Google's native integrations. For most SEO use cases pulling Search Console and GA4 data, you pay nothing. DashThis starts at $49/month for 3 dashboards and scales to $449/month for unlimited dashboards with white-label branding. The pricing jumps significantly if you need more than a handful of clients, making it expensive for larger agencies. However, the time savings often justify the cost—agencies bill the dashboard setup time to clients anyway.
Best For
Looker Studio is better when you need complex data analysis, custom calculations, or integration with unusual data sources. If you're comfortable with data visualization tools and want complete control over dashboard design, the free price point makes it unbeatable. It's ideal for in-house teams and consultants who can invest setup time upfront. DashThis works better for agencies managing multiple clients who need consistent, professional-looking reports delivered automatically. The pre-built templates and one-click report generation save significant time, especially when you're billing clients for reporting services. It's worth the cost if you value speed over customization.
The Verdict
Choose Looker Studio if budget is a concern or you need advanced data manipulation features. The learning curve is steep, but the platform is genuinely powerful and costs nothing. Choose DashThis if you're running an agency and need to deliver client reports quickly and consistently. The time savings justify the monthly fee, especially when you can bill setup costs to clients.
